Spline connection
A spline connection having a hub with a toothing profile on the inner circumference, an axle journal having a toothing profile on an outer circumferential portion, a shoulder for axial support and/or abutment against the hub, and a tensioning device for axially bracing the axle journal with the hub. The hub has a constant toothing profile and the axle journal has a first portion and a second portion with different toothing profiles. The first portion is arranged on the insertion side to be further away from the shoulder than the second portion and has a constant toothing profile with play with respect to the toothing profile of the hub. The second portion is arranged on the shoulder side and has a toothing profile which has reduced tooth spaces compared with the first portion and which is play-free with respect to the toothing profile of the hub.
Method for producing drop centre rims, drop centre rim and vehicle wheel therewith for commercial vehicles
A method for producing a drop centre rim and to a drop centre rim for vehicle wheels of commercial vehicles. The rim has a plurality of zones, which form an inner rim flange and an outer rim flange, an inner steep-tapered bead seat and an outer steep-tapered bead seat and a rim drop centre with a drop centre base, an inner drop centre flank and an outer drop centre flank between the steep-tapered bead seats, wherein one of the zones is provided as a disc attachment region for a wheel disc, and the drop centre rim has at least one partial zone with a reduced wall thickness relative to the other zones. It is envisaged that at least one of the steep-tapered bead seats, preferably both steep-tapered bead seats, has/have a section with a wall thickness reduction of more than 20% relative to the wall thickness in the zone provided as the disc attachment region, wherein the wall thickness reduction is produced during one of the profiling steps.
METHOD FOR MANUFACTURING A ONE-PIECE WHEEL BY FORGING AND A ONE-PIECE WHEEL MANUFACTURED THEREBY
A method for manufacturing a one-piece wheel by forging includes: producing an integral forging comprising: a disc portion, a rim portion, and an annular protrusion protruding from one side of the disc portion in a forging method; producing an outer bend by bending the annular protrusion through a flow-forming process; and forming a hollow portion by welding one end of the outer bend to one side of the rim portion. The method manufactures the one-piece wheel having stronger shear strength and stiffness and better fatigue life even while reducing the noise using the forging method.
VEHICLE WHEEL DISC, VEHICLE WHEEL INCLUDING SUCH A WHEEL DISC AND METHOD FOR PRODUCING SUCH A WHEEL DISC AND VEHICLE WHEEL
A wheel disc includes a hub located centrally within the wheel disc and defining a wheel axis. The wheel disc further includes an outer circumferential edge and a transition portion radially extending between the hub and the outer circumferential edge. The transition portion has a front surface and a rear surface such that the front surface has a relatively smooth profile and the rear surface has a plurality of concentric ring-shaped curvatures formed therein, thereby providing the transition portion with a variable thickness between the front and rear surfaces.
VEHICLE WHEEL DISC, VEHICLE WHEEL INCLUDING SUCH A WHEEL DISC AND METHOD FOR PRODUCING SUCH A WHEEL DISC AND VEHICLE WHEEL
A full face fabricated vehicle wheel having a wheel attached to a wheel disc. The wheel disc includes a hub located centrally within the wheel disc and defining a wheel axis. The wheel disc further includes an outer circumferential edge having an outboard bead seat retaining flange, and an annular transition portion radially extending between the hub and the outer circumferential edge. The transition portion includes a plurality of vent hole regions circumferentially spaced around the transition portion about the wheel axis. At least one vent hole region includes a vent hole formed through the transition portion and defining an outer perimeter such that at least two bridging portions extend inwardly from the perimeter which subdivides the vent hole into at least three smaller holes formed through the transition portion at the at least one vent hole region.

Automobile wheel hub shaping device
The present disclosure discloses an automobile wheel hub shaping device. The automobile wheel hub shaping device includes a clamping part for clamping a wheel hub to be shaped, a first driving mechanism for driving the clamping part to rotate, a shaping roller for shaping the wheel hub to be shaped, and a rack; all the clamping part, the first driving mechanism and the shaping roller are mounted to the rack, the shaping roller is located above the clamping part and is capable of rotating relative to the clamping part; and the clamping part is equipped with a fixing part for fixing the wheel hub to be shaped.

Drive wheel bearing and method of manufacturing the same
Disclosed are a drive wheel bearing and a method of manufacturing the same. The drive wheel bearing includes: a wheel hub which is integrally and rotatably fastened to a vehicle wheel; an inner race which is fitted with the wheel hub and integrally and rotatably coupled to the wheel hub; an outer race which rotatably supports the wheel hub and the inner race in a state in which the wheel hub and the inner race are fitted into the outer race; rolling elements which are interposed between the outer race and the wheel hub and between the outer race and the inner race; and a constant velocity joint which is integrally and rotatably connected to the wheel hub or the inner race by means of a face spline in order to receive power from an engine and transmit the received power to the vehicle wheel, in which the face spline of each of the wheel hub and the constant velocity joint have a structure in which teeth having the same size and tooth grooves having the same size radially extend, and are alternately and continuously arranged in a circumferential direction, and as a result, it is possible to smoothly transmit rotational power of the engine to the vehicle wheel through the wheel bearing.
